Description:
Enable 'log_retention_days' on 'PostgreSQL Servers'.
Rationale:
Enabling 'log_retention_days' helps PostgreSQL Database to 'Sets number of days a log file is retained' which in turn generates query and error logs. Query and error logs can be used to identify, troubleshoot, and repair configuration errors and sub-optimal performance.
Enabling this setting will enable logs to be retained for the number entered. If this is enabled for a high traffic server, the log may grow quickly to occupy a large amount of disk space. In this case you may want to set this to a lower number.
